Türkiye’s President Recep Tayyip Erdogan has announced a fresh discovery of a new oil reserve in the country’s eastern region. “I’d like to share some fresh good news. We have discovered oil reserves with a production capacity of 100,000 barrels per day in Cudi and Gabar,” the president said on Tuesday at an opening ceremony of the Karapinar solar power plant and other newly-completed projects in central Konya province.
